Bengaluru-based UpKraft, an AI-powered extracurricular learning platform, has raised ₹1.6 crore in a pre-seed funding round led by PedalStart. The round comprises a curated group of angel investors, entrepreneurs, operators, and early-stage ecosystem participants who share UpKraft’s vision of transforming extracurricular learning through technology and hyperlocal delivery.
Co-founded by Tejasvi Singh Kushwah, Varun Mangal and Kritika Varandani, UpKraft delivers expert-led structured, world-class extracurricular learning at homes, in societies, and in schools. The capital raised will be deployed by UpKraft to accelerate AI product development – including personalized learning, practice analytics, and tutor productivity tools- expand UpKraft’s presence across Bengaluru and Gurugram through its hyperlocal, community-led growth model, strengthen its technology platform, operations, and customer experience, and build high-performing teams across product, technology, growth, sales, and tutor-led operations.

Over the next 12-18 months, UpKraft’s focus is to significantly expand its student enrollments, deepen market penetration across Bengaluru and Gurugram, and improve learning outcomes, while strengthening teams across Product & Engineering, AI & Data Science, Sales & Business Development, Community & Field Marketing, Customer Success, and Tutor Network onboarding and operations. This round provides the foundation to validate UpKraft’s model at scale before raising larger institutional capital to accelerate national and international expansion.

A significant portion of the investment will accelerate the development of UpKraft’s AI-powered learning ecosystem, including an AI Practice Companion for personalized feedback, intelligent practice tracking and performance analytics, adaptive learning journeys based on student progress, tutor productivity and classroom management tools, parent dashboards with real-time progress insights, and an expanded curriculum across multiple extracurricular categories.
Unlike traditional tutoring marketplaces or standalone academies, UpKraft combines AI-powered personalized learning and practice analytics, a standardized curriculum with measurable outcomes, verified instructors, and community-based delivery at students’ doorstep, along with parent progress tracking and technology that improves tutor productivity and student retention.
